Experiment on Shearing Demulsification of W/O Emulsion

Abstract: In order to study the feasibility of the shearing demulsification of W/O emulsion, a Couette double-cylinder device was designed to form a lamina flow, and its shear intensity was controlled by the rotate speed of the inner cylinder. The force of single droplet is analyzed according to hydrokinetics, and the affine deformation model is put forward and validated by experiment which basically agreed with Taylor G I and Cox R G theory. The results show that shear is propitious to droplets aggregation. Based on the relation curve of droplets diameter with the revolution of inner cylinder, it was found when the rotation velocity of inner cylinder is 50~150 r/min ( shearing strenghth of 8.67~26.01 Pa), the maximal diameter and average diameter are all larger than that of droplets which are not in shear flow. It was shown that shear can accelerate droplets aggregation only within a valid shear range. Therefore,a proper shear flow can be introduced into the separate device to improve the separate efficiency of W/O emulsion.
